git.cweiske.de
/
enigma2.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
lock on pids only if video startcode is in a pes header
[enigma2.git]
/
lib
/
dvb
/
scan.cpp
diff --git
a/lib/dvb/scan.cpp
b/lib/dvb/scan.cpp
index 2a08bf79701d0ad7136683bfea48d95e3c6c010e..2457763ae1bd1047c53c6cb08449ef32aee5ac6c 100644
(file)
--- a/
lib/dvb/scan.cpp
+++ b/
lib/dvb/scan.cpp
@@
-205,7
+205,7
@@
RESULT eDVBScan::startFilter()
if (m_ready_all & readyPAT)
{
m_PAT = new eTable<ProgramAssociationSection>(m_scan_debug);
if (m_ready_all & readyPAT)
{
m_PAT = new eTable<ProgramAssociationSection>(m_scan_debug);
- if (m_PAT->start(m_demux, eDVBPATSpec()))
+ if (m_PAT->start(m_demux, eDVBPATSpec(
4000
)))
return -1;
CONNECT(m_PAT->tableReady, eDVBScan::PATready);
}
return -1;
CONNECT(m_PAT->tableReady, eDVBScan::PATready);
}
@@
-376,7
+376,7
@@
void eDVBScan::PMTready(int err)
}
if (m_pmt_in_progress != m_pmts_to_read.end())
}
if (m_pmt_in_progress != m_pmts_to_read.end())
- m_PMT->start(m_demux, eDVBPMTSpec(m_pmt_in_progress->second.pmtPid, m_pmt_in_progress->first));
+ m_PMT->start(m_demux, eDVBPMTSpec(m_pmt_in_progress->second.pmtPid, m_pmt_in_progress->first
, 4000
));
else
{
m_PMT = 0;
else
{
m_PMT = 0;